People who do not have coronavirus symptoms can have just as much virus in their system as those who are hospitalized with COVID-19, and some people carry far higher loads of coronavirus than others, according to two new studies by University of Colorado Boulder researchers.
The studies used data from more than 72,000 saliva samples collected primarily from CU Boulder students and some faculty and staff members between Aug. 17 and Nov. 25 through the campus coronavirus monitoring program.
